------- Additional Comments From dje at gcc dot gnu dot org 2003-06-28 02:39 -------
This is not a bug in GCC. The problem is that AIX 5.2 adds support for
atoll(), but the cached copy of stdlib.h from AIX 5.1 and earlier do not have a
prototype, so the return argument is interpreted incorrectly. The fix is to
remove the "fixed" header file from the GCC cache of the version of GCC used to
bootstrap on AIX 5.2.
